Sealant

Window sealants (also called window caulking or window silicon) play a key role in maintaining the quality of windows and enhancing efficiency of energy. The application of window silicone is an art that requires practice. Incorrectly applied sealant can result in air leaks, draughts and higher energy bills. Mastering the art of applying window gaskets replacement sealant can prevent these problems and help homeowners save money in the end.

There are many different types of sealants for windows and it is crucial to choose the appropriate one for your specific project. For instance, certain types of sealants are more suited to certain materials and others are more suited to different weather conditions. Certain sealants require longer time to set than others. To avoid wasting time and money, always test a new formula to ensure it's suitable for your specific project.

Whatever type of window sealant you choose to use, it is important to prepare the surface prior to beginning the work. Wipe off any dirt or dust using a damp rag. If the gap is dirty or dusty, it will not stick to the caulk and may compromise the insulation of your window. You can also employ a utility knife to scrape away any extra material.

After cleaning the area, apply primer. This will ensure that the window sealant will adhere properly. After the primer has dried and the primer is dry, you can apply the actual sealant. Read the instructions provided by the manufacturer before you begin. You can purchase a caulking tool to help make the process more efficient. There are online tutorials that can help you understand the basics. Once you are comfortable with the tool, start applying the sealant in a line from one end to the next. When you're done pressing the pressure-release catch on the caulking tool in order to prevent any further product from leaking.

Depending on the thickness of your beads, it could take anywhere from 12 to 15 hours for the caulk to set. After this time you can lightly sand the sealant using the aid of a sanding machine to give a nice finish.

Removal

Few components of a structure provide more value for every dollar spent than window seals. These thin strips protect the interior of the building and its contents from the weather, while also contributing to energy efficiency. They must be treated with respect and care. It is crucial to examine and repair them when needed in order to achieve optimal results.

A broken window seal can cause a number of issues. Moisture may cause fogging of the windows, which can reduce visibility and impacting indoor comfort. Excessive physical impacts along the frames caused by children pets, pets, or cleaning tools can deteriorate and dislodge window seals prior to their time. Draughts can also pass through a cracked seal, increasing heating costs.

It is not a difficult task to replace the double glazing window seal repair seal, however it may require some invasive work to access the frame. The best place to begin is a thorough assessment of the condition of the seal. After this the new seal can be placed in the correct location by a simple push.

The type of double glazing window seal replacement that you are working with will determine the tool you will use. A flathead screwdriver is sufficient for the majority of jobs. But, if the seal is stuck in the window, you'll require the right tool to remove it.

When the old seal has been removed clean the area thoroughly using water and mild detergent. This will help eliminate any residue left behind which will allow the new seal to stick to the frame. Then the filler strip will be installed.

The filler strip can be made of either rubber or a caulk like substance. Some manufacturers offer a hybrid that has a wedge on bubble for additional insulation and resistance against draughts.

Whatever the material, it is essential to follow the instructions of the manufacturer regarding care. This will ensure the highest performance. It is important to keep the window seals dry and clean and to wash them often using mild soap and warm water.

Preparation

One of the most crucial steps in a window seal replacement sealed units near me is to thoroughly clean the surface that will be receiving the new sealant or caulk. This step is often overlooked however it is essential for creating a durable and long-lasting bond between the sealant and the surface to which it will stick. The best way to do this is to use a cloth soaked in a water and mild detergent solution.

It is also essential to wash any areas of the frame or window gasket replacement that might have grease or other residues on them, as they could hinder the adhesion of the new sealant. It is an excellent idea to make sure that the windows are correctly fitted and working well. If the frames are warped, for example, this can put pressure on the glass and cause gaps where air can be able to pass through, which can reduce the insulation properties.

After the windows' frames and glass panes have been cleaned, it is time to prepare the windows for a new sealant. This is done by scrubbing the surface with a sponge or damp cloth. After that, a small amount of alcohol-based solution can be applied to the sealant's surface to break down any remaining adhesive and make it easier to wipe away.

It is essential to read the care instructions prior to applying an all-new sealant. These are often very simple, and they can be an excellent way to extend the lifespan of the seal.

Installation

Window seals are an important component of every window. They can help ensure energy efficiency and stop water intrusion. They don't last forever and you should be looking for signs of wear or damage. Fogging of windows is among the most frequent signs of a broken seal. The moisture seeps through the glass panes and causes window fog, which can be difficult to get rid of. It's important to contact a professional window contractor and have your windows resealed in the earliest time possible to prevent any damage from occurring.

The good news is that it's possible to extend the life of your window seals by observing some easy maintenance tips. Read the manufacturer's instructions for your specific window seal. These instructions are typically found on the frame of the window and could contain information on cleaning methods or cleaners.

Another suggestion is to look for cracks or gaps around the edges of your window. These cracks or gaps are a sign that the window seal has failed and needs to be addressed right away. In the end, it's an ideal idea to have your windows inspected by a professional at least twice per year. This will allow you to catch any problems before they affect the comfort of your home or causing structural damage.

In an inspection, professionals will look for indications that the seal backing has been damaged or damaged or worn. This could be caused by the residue of tools or hands on the backing of the seal or on the frame, a gap between glass and the frame, or any other issues. The inspector can then recommend the proper course of action for repairs or replacement.

A window seal that is damaged is an extremely serious issue for your home. It could cause serious problems, including moisture intrusion. Window seals are a crucial part of any window. It is crucial to be aware of the signs of damage, to ensure that you get them repaired as quickly as possible.
